AutoProject for AutoCAD
|
|
| |
| AutoProject for AutoCAD is a plug-in for AutoCAD 2000, 2000i, 2002 and 2004. This plug-in gives AutoCAD the ability to project 3D entities to 2D entities in the XY plane in the AutoCAD model space.
A common but inefficient method of creating workshop ready drawings is to create the top view, the front view, a side view and sometimes an isometric view of a 3D model all in the 2D XY plane. Then these 3 or 4 views are placed relative to each other to give the end user a complete idea of what the 3D model is all about. Experienced draftsmen have confirmed that the isometric view is the one that takes most of the time, whereas the orthographic views only end up adding to the time spent in completing the drawing. A closer look at this method will show you that, in effect, you are drawing a single entity 4 times over, one for each view.
With AutoProject for AutoCAD you can drastically reduce the time spent in creating a workshop ready drawing, while making full use of the AutoCAD 3D functionality. All you have to do is create a 3D drawing of the model you wish to describe and AutoProject for AutoCAD will take care of the rest. With AutoProject for AutoCAD you can create 6 orthographic views and 8 isometric views within no time.
AutoProject for AutoCAD is very easy to use as it adds several commands to AutoCAD. You simply type a command at the AutoCAD command prompt, select the entities you wish to project and the job is done. |

NC Editor
|
|
| |
| NC Editor is a Numerical Control (.NC) file viewing, editing and printing application. CNC Machines worldwide use Numeric Control files (.nc or .ncc) to convert programmed instructions to tool movement. NC programs consist of a sequence of codes with parameter data to arrive at a precise description of the tool path. But the best of NC programmers also can make mistakes. NC Editor renders a 3D image of your NC program to let you verify that everything is how you planned it to be.
NC Editor has been designed keeping CNC programmers in mind. Below are some of the features incorporated in this incredible editor:
Opens and works with multiple NC files simultaneously.
Animation/Backplot capability.
Imports NC commands from any text file
Print and Print Preview capabilities.
Undo operations.
Support for clipboard operations.
Automatic E-mailing of NC files.
Rotate, Zoom and Pan the drawing with the mouse.
Predefined Axis and Isometric views
Perspective and Orthographic projection.
Global and per file configuration.
Context-sensitive help system. |

Spriteforge 3D 2 2D Spriteset Renderer
|
|
| |
| Overview of Purpose:
What is SpriteForge?
SpriteForge is essentialy a tool for creating large numbers of 2D sprites from 3D models. You can 'photoraph' your model's animation frames (or simply it's static profile) from several different camera angles in just a few easy steps. Primarily designed for creating game sprites, spriteForge is also great for making 3D website graphics (ie spinning 3D logos), taking photos of a 3D model for sale, avatars for chatrooms, testing a model's animation, spriteForge has a multitude of uses, think of it as an advanced photo studio for your 3D models!
With SpriteForge you can even create sequences of many models at once, then simply choose the orbit positions and elevation you require. This makes SpriteForge perfect for creating for example; 2D 45'orthographic characters for an RPG style game, animated in all 8 directions!
How is it helpful over my 3D program's Renderer?
Take a 'top down' RPG, where everything has to be at an orthographic 30' camera elevation and in all 8 rotations (N NE E SE S SW W NW).
One very common practise to use a 3d modeller's output to do this. However, this can take a lot time to set up using camera paths etc, or for more basic users the old: 'move camera, take pic, move camera, take pic....' aproach. Imagine all the organising and planning, especially if you have lots of models to process that all have to follow the same pattern. In addition, with a modellers output its hard to get the frame dimensions to sprite ratio right, with SpriteForge you get it exactly right. (and if you so desire in a nice table!).
Finally, you can save your custom settings (or studio environment) for repeated use. |
